we read this book for my book club - really interesting reading about the ascendency of the "girls gone wild" culture in the US and how that relates (or doesnt) to feminism. This article does a good job of summarizing the complex forces behind the rise of the"not that innocent" phenomena.
Quoted: Embracing a caricaturish sexuality, women are confusing erotic power with real-world power, says Ariel Levy.

A co-worker recommended this photography book featuring people of indigenous cultures. Proceeds benefit CARE's international work to assist those in need.
Quoted: Phil Borges People of Indigenous Cultures - Photography Books Prints - Phil Borges has lived with and documented indigenous and tribal cultures around the world. Through his work, he strives to create a heightened understanding of the issues faced by people in the developing world.
